What Is MSNBC and How Did It Begin?

MSNBC, short for Microsoft/NBC, was launched on July 15, 1996, as a joint venture between Microsoft and NBC. The network was initially conceived as a 24-hour cable news channel, aiming to compete with established players like CNN. Its name reflects the partnership between the two companies, though Microsoft sold its stake in 2004, leaving NBCUniversal as the sole owner. Despite this change, MSNBC retained its name and continued to grow as a prominent news outlet.

  • In its early years, MSNBC focused on general news coverage, but it soon pivoted to a more opinion-driven format. This shift was driven by the success of its primetime lineup, which featured progressive voices and in-depth political analysis. Shows like "Countdown with Keith Olbermann" and later "The Rachel Maddow Show" helped establish MSNBC as a platform for progressive thought leadership. This strategic move not only attracted a dedicated audience but also set the stage for its future growth.
